TULSA, Okla. (Oct. 22, 2020) – Major League Fishing (MLF) announced today the 2021 MLF Bass Pro Tour schedule, which will showcase the best bass anglers in the world competing on many of the top fisheries in the United States. The 2021 Bass Pro Tour season will run from March to September and feature seven regular-season tournaments. MLF will also host four MLF Cups, REDCREST and the MLF General Tire Heavy Hitters – an all-star event that highlights the 40 anglers from the Bass Pro Tour with the highest cumulative weight from their single largest bass in each
of the five regular-season events held in 2020.
“We are hitting these lakes and rivers at the right time for incredible competition. I’m expecting the Bass Pro Tour anglers to keep SCORETRACKER busy all year long,” said Michael Mulone, Senior Director of Events & Partnerships for MLF. “Our host cities understand the power of our brand and are primed and ready to welcome our anglers, staff, sponsors and fans. We are so grateful for their continued partnerships and are looking forward to bringing fast-paced, fan-friendly competition to their communities and to our fans worldwide.”
Each stage of the Bass Pro Tour includes six days of competition using the catch, weigh, immediate-release format, broadcast live on the Major League Fishing app, MyOutdoorTV (MOTV), and MajorLeagueFishing.com, totaling more than 450 hours of original programming. Fans can also follow the on-the-water action as it unfolds on the live SCORETRACKER® leaderboard.
The 2021 MLF Bass Pro Tour will air on Discovery Channel beginning in July 2021 and Sportsman Channel in early 2022.
In MLF Bass Pro Tour competition, anglers are vying for valuable points in hopes of qualifying for REDCREST, the world championship of professional bass fishing. REDCREST 2021 will feature the REDCREST Expo, February 26-28, at Expo Square in Tulsa, Oklahoma – a free, family-friendly event featuring all the new products and gear in the fishing, boating and outdoor industry.
2021 MLF Bass Pro Tour Schedule
Feb. 23-27REDCREST at Grand Lake O’ the Cherokees Tulsa, Okla.
Hosted by Visit Tulsa
March 21-26Bass Pro Tour Stage One at Sam Rayburn Reservoir Jasper, TexasHosted by Jasper County Development District &Jasper-Lake Sam Rayburn Area Chamber of Commerce
April 9-14General Tire HEAVY HITTERSat Falls Lake, Jordan Lake & Shearon Harris Reservoir Raleigh, N.C.Hosted by the Greater Raleigh Sports Alliance
April 30-May 5Bass Pro Tour Stage Two at Lake Travis Austin, TexasHosted by the Austin Sports Commission
May 21-26Bass Pro Tour Stage Three at Harris Chain of Lakes Leesburg, Fla.Hosted by Lake County, FL & City of Leesburg
June 4-9Bass Pro Tour Stage Four at Lake Chickamauga Dayton, Tenn.Hosted by Fish Dayton
June 25-30Bass Pro Tour Stage Five at St. Lawrence River Massena, N.Y.Hosted by the Town of Massena
Aug. 5-10Bass Pro Tour Stage Six at Lake Champlain Plattsburgh, N.Y.Hosted by the Adirondack Coast Visitors Bureau and the City of Plattsburgh
Sept. 10-15Bass Pro Tour Stage Seven at Lake St. Clair St. Clair Shores, Mich.Hosted by Macomb County, St. Clair Shores and the Detroit Sports Commission
